1. Tents with Fire Stoves for Enhanced Comfort

If you're planning a camping trip in the winter, having a tent with a wood stove is a must. A wood stove, also known as a portable small wood stove, is a great way to keep warm and comfortable during cold nights. Many tents designed for winter camping come with a chimney socket, which allows you to place the wood stove inside. The stove pipe discharge smoke through the chimney socket, providing both warmth and a cozy atmosphere.
